Page MenuHomePhabricator

Deploy FileExporter and FileImporter to de-,fa- and ar-wiki as a beta feature
Closed, ResolvedPublic3 Story Points

Description

Motivation
Importing files to Commons is a wish from the Technical Wishlist of de-wiki. The first version is ready to be tested, and hence it is time for the small beta phase! Per community requests we will also deploy the FileExporter extension to fa- and ar-wiki. The FileImporter will be deployed on Commons, but is only accessible through the FileExporter.

Task

  • Create a patch to enable the FileExporter on de, fa and ar-wiki as a beta feature
  • Enable the FileImporter on Commons
  • Reserve a SWAT slot on June 25 2018
  • Support doing the deploy

Event Timeline

Lea_WMDE renamed this task from Deploy FileExporter and FileImporter to de-,fa- and ar-wiki to Deploy FileExporter and FileImporter to de-,fa- and ar-wiki as a beta feature.Jun 12 2018, 8:57 AM
Lea_WMDE updated the task description. (Show Details)
Lea_WMDE set the point value for this task to 3.

Change 440860 had a related patch set uploaded (by WMDE-Fisch; owner: WMDE-Fisch):
[operations/mediawiki-config@master] Add ar, de and fa wikipedia to FileImporter interwiki config

https://gerrit.wikimedia.org/r/440860

Gilles removed a subscriber: Gilles.Jun 18 2018, 1:39 PM

Patches that need to be deployed/backported before actually activating this:

Hardcoded Interwiki handling config patch:
https://gerrit.wikimedia.org/r/#/c/operations/mediawiki-config/+/440860/
Hardcoded Interwiki handling extension patch: ( needs backport )
https://gerrit.wikimedia.org/r/#/c/mediawiki/extensions/FileImporter/+/440857/
Enable CommonsHelperConfig for production:
https://gerrit.wikimedia.org/r/#/c/operations/mediawiki-config/+/440864/

Blocked a block for this on Monday after the midday SWAT. @Addshore was so kind to provide his services again for the deployment(s) :-)
https://wikitech.wikimedia.org/w/index.php?title=Deployments&type=revision&diff=1795107&oldid=1794890

Change 441013 had a related patch set uploaded (by WMDE-Fisch; owner: WMDE-Fisch):
[operations/mediawiki-config@master] Enable FileImporter on Wikimedia Commons

https://gerrit.wikimedia.org/r/441013

Change 441014 had a related patch set uploaded (by WMDE-Fisch; owner: WMDE-Fisch):
[operations/mediawiki-config@master] Enable FileExpoter on ar-, de- and fa-wiki

https://gerrit.wikimedia.org/r/441014

Change 440860 merged by jenkins-bot:
[operations/mediawiki-config@master] Add ar, de and fa wikipedia to FileImporter interwiki config

https://gerrit.wikimedia.org/r/440860

Mentioned in SAL (#wikimedia-operations) [2018-06-25T14:19:15Z] <addshore@deploy1001> Synchronized wmf-config/CommonSettings.php: [[gerrit:440860|Add ar, de and fa wikipedia to FileImporter interwiki config]] T196969 T196976 (duration: 00m 56s)

Change 441013 merged by jenkins-bot:
[operations/mediawiki-config@master] Enable FileImporter on Wikimedia Commons

https://gerrit.wikimedia.org/r/441013

Mentioned in SAL (#wikimedia-operations) [2018-06-25T14:57:02Z] <addshore@deploy1001> Synchronized wmf-config/InitialiseSettings.php: [[gerrit:441013|Enable FileImporter on Wikimedia Commons]] T196969 (duration: 00m 56s)

Change 441014 merged by jenkins-bot:
[operations/mediawiki-config@master] Enable FileExpoter on ar-, de- and fa-wiki

https://gerrit.wikimedia.org/r/441014

Mentioned in SAL (#wikimedia-operations) [2018-06-25T15:03:41Z] <addshore@deploy1001> Synchronized wmf-config/InitialiseSettings.php: [[gerrit:441014|Enable FileExpoter on ar-, de- and fa-wiki]] T196969 T197066 (duration: 00m 57s)

Done see the wikis ;-)

First image transferred as part of testing this on the debug servers before complete rollout:

https://commons.wikimedia.org/wiki/File:Wander_Bertoni_Prora.jpg

I manually translated the templates and fields here .... the magic will be available in the near future :-)

Vvjjkkii renamed this task from Deploy FileExporter and FileImporter to de-,fa- and ar-wiki as a beta feature to y7aaaaaaaa.Jul 1 2018, 1:05 AM
Vvjjkkii raised the priority of this task from Normal to High.
Vvjjkkii removed WMDE-Fisch as the assignee of this task.
Vvjjkkii updated the task description. (Show Details)
Vvjjkkii removed the point value for this task.
Vvjjkkii removed subscribers: Aklapper, gerritbot.
CommunityTechBot set the point value for this task to 3.Jul 2 2018, 9:12 AM
CommunityTechBot updated the task description. (Show Details)
CommunityTechBot assigned this task to WMDE-Fisch.
CommunityTechBot lowered the priority of this task from High to Normal.
CommunityTechBot renamed this task from y7aaaaaaaa to Deploy FileExporter and FileImporter to de-,fa- and ar-wiki as a beta feature.
CommunityTechBot added subscribers: Aklapper, gerritbot.
Lea_WMDE closed this task as Resolved.Jul 3 2018, 1:00 PM
Lea_WMDE moved this task from Demo to Done on the WMDE-QWERTY-Sprint-2018-06-19 board.